Should You Buy Or Adopt a Pet?
Consider adopting an animal from a rescue group or shelter if you're seeking to add a pet to your family. It's much less expensive than buying from a breeder or pet store.
Adopting a pet can be an unforgettable experience. When you adopt, you will receive an overview of the pet and generally receive support through any initial familiarization period.
1. Save a Life
Millions of stray, abandoned and lost animals are rescued each year, and many are put to death because of overpopulation. By adopting a pet, you directly save the life of the animal. Adopting a pet also allows the adoption of another homeless animal at the shelter. This kind gesture can save lives.
If you choose to adopt a pet, you're preventing unnecessary killing of millions loving and healthy animals every year. Many of these animals are killed due to a inadequate space in overcrowded shelters and the number of euthanized animals could be dramatically reduced when more people consider adoption instead of purchasing an animal from a breeder. Adopting a pet isn't only the best way to find the perfect companion, but also the best method to save the lives of a lot of other animals. This is a win-win situation for everyone!
2. Save a Home
Every year millions of animals are put to death in shelters due to not having enough space. Adopting a pet can directly influence the problem of overpopulation and save a life. Adoption also provides shelters with resources and allows them to continue their vital work while breaking the cycle of overpopulation of pets. Adoption is a compassionate decision because it directly addresses the issue of overpopulation. Millions of animals enter shelters each year, and a large portion are killed because of overcrowding or a lack of resources. Adopting an animal allows another pet to be saved and rescued.
Pet adoption can also help to end the cycle of pet overpopulation, by reducing the demand for animals that are sold by breeders and pet stores. Each year 8 to 12 million cats, dogs, kittens and puppies are put to death because there are not enough homes for them. Adopting a pet could help reduce the number of animals killed and also reduce the need for animals being raised in unsanitary conditions.
Many shelters also have a range of animals available for adoption. You can adopt a puppy or kitten or take a pet that has been housetrained. This will save you money, time and effort as you won't have to deal with the puppy/kitten phase.
